Epidemiologist Dr. Donald Francis on this archival edition of Fresh Air. In the mid 1970's he was in Sudan helping to contain the Ebola virus, which had then just been identified. Francis was also on the forefront of research on AIDS and the HIV virus. He was director of the CDC's AIDS Laboratory Activities, and worked closely with the Institut Pasteur to prove that HIV was the cause of AIDS. Francis is currently doing research to develop a vaccine for HIV. (Original Broadcast Date: May 18, 1995) Language: English. Narrator: Terry Gross. Epidemiologist and one of the world's leading experts on Alzheimer's disease, David Snowdon, on this archive edition of Fresh Air. In 1986 Snowdon began what he calls the Nun Study, following a group of aging nuns to better understand why some of the sisters were able to age gracefully, retaining their mental faculties, and others were not. He studied 678 nuns who belonged to The School Sisters of Notre Dame. His study was published in The Journal of Personality and Social Psychology. It's also the subject of Snowdon's book, Aging with Grace: What the Nun Study Teaches Us About Leading Longer, Healthier, and More Meaningful Lives. Snowdon is Professor of Neurology at the University of Kentucky Medical Center. (Original Broadcast Date: May 8, 2001) Language: English. Narrator: Terry Gross. Containing important information about the coronavirus, this comprehensive, easy-to-follow primer on pandemics, epidemics, and the panics they ignite around the world also shares solutions for a safer, healthier future. "A quiet little gem of understanding in a cacophony of panic and fear." -Quill & Quire, STARRED review Authored by a leading epidemiologist, this engrossing book answers our questions about animal diseases that jump to humans-called zoonoses-including what attracts them to humans, why they have become more common in recent history, and how we can keep them at bay. Almost all pandemics and epidemics have been caused by diseases that come to us from animals, including SARS, Ebola, and-now-Covid-19. Epidemiologist, veterinarian, and ecosystem health specialist, David Waltner-Toews, gathers the latest research to profile dozens of illnesses in On Pandemics. Chapters are broken into short, dynamic explainers, each one tackling a different disease. Readers will discover: Why zoonotic diseases jump from animals to humans-and why some decide to stick around for good. How governments have responded to pandemics and epidemics throughout history, for better or for worse. The role of climate change, industrialized farming, cultural practices, biodiversity loss, and globalization in making these diseases not only possible, but inevitable outcomes of our modern lifestyles. Coronaviruses, such as those that cause SARS and Covid-19, have likely made bats their home for centuries. Until SARS came along, we didn't know they were there, nor do we know how many other death-dealing viruses might be living undetected in wildlife. On Pandemics shows the greater impact of animal-borne diseases on our world, and encourages us to re-examine our role in pandemics, if not for our own health, then for the health of our planet. Published originally in 2007 as The Chickens Fight Back: Pandemic Panics and Deadly Diseases that Jump from Animals to Humans, this book has been updated in light of the COVID-19 pandemic.
